The purpose of this article is an attempt to analyze the Quranic motifs and plots in the works of a number of Russian poets, such as Lukyan Yakubovich (1805-1839), Yakov Polonsky (1819-1898), Nikolai Grekov (1807-1866), Nikolai Karabchevsky (1852-1925), Mikhail Mikhailov (1829-1862) and Leo Kobylinsky-Ellis (1879-1947). Analyzing the issue of borrowing the content of the verses of the Quran and interpreting their meaning, as a way of expressing Quranic motifs in certain poems of the above-mentioned poets, the author of the article reveals that their poetry exactly follows the Quranic meanings and connotations. The methodology of this article is determined by the theory of a complex approach to the studied material, which allows us to consider certain verses of these poets as an example of oriental poetry with a pronounced Quranic theme. The novelty of the study lies in the fact that it attempt to analyze in detail the Quranic themes in the eastern lyrics of the named poets, whose works on Quranic themes have neither been put into scientific circulation, nor sufficiently developed in criticism and remain understudied. The author of the article concludes that Quranic literature played an important role in the works of Russian poets, whose poems were the object of analysis in this article.
